From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 5FFBEC48297 for ; Fri, 9 Feb 2024 10:55:20 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id C942B6B0088; Fri, 9 Feb 2024 05:55:19 -0500 (EST) Received: by kanga.kvack.org (Postfix, from userid 40) id C44B56B0089; Fri, 9 Feb 2024 05:55:19 -0500 (EST)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id B0B746B008A; Fri, 9 Feb 2024 05:55:19 -0500 (EST)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0010.hostedemail.com [216.40.44.10]) by kanga.kvack.org (Postfix) with ESMTP id 991736B0088 for ; Fri, 9 Feb 2024 05:55:19 -0500 (EST) Received: from smtpin12.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ay09.hostedemail.com (Postfix) with ESMTP id 45AA6803EC for ; Fri, 9 Feb 2024 10:55:19 +0000 (UTC) X-FDA: 81771958758.12.931103B Received: from mail-ej1-f44.google.com (mail-ej1-f44.google.com [209.85.218.44]) by imf25.hostedemail.com (Postfix) with ESMTP id 49500A0014 for ; Fri, 9 Feb 2024 10:55:17 +0000 (UTC) Authentication-Results: imf25.hostedemail.com; dkim=pass header.d=gmail.com header.s=20230601 header.b="BSRl/zcj"; dmarc=pass (policy=none) header.from=gmail.com; spf=pass (imf25.hostedemail.com: domain of jernej.skrabec@gmail.com designates 209.85.218.44 as permitted sender) smtp.mailfrom=jernej.skrabec@gmail.com 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1707476117;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=VPDCxvBNMC7jVwM9lF/rwisiu2UQZms91Q9LKR4ZUe8=; b=OWYtuyIxHca6YgWHnww7YLe1Udbv42YhDbHQ+jgSkAK68ncoiTd8WfdG5xzQw1l82M2Vwl 1Z0DifP+ifbb1a7ePUxBIb/suG6FSD5QsG6MHrLQv2PgURFEwhGHnLJayA005C5WbxPAIC gKcvt7sX9o14USX4gztHRO9h5aai0g4= ARC-Authentication-Results: i=1; imf25.hostedemail.com; dkim=pass header.d=gmail.com header.s=20230601 header.b="BSRl/zcj"; dmarc=pass (policy=none) header.from=gmail.com; spf=pass (imf25.hostedemail.com: domain of jernej.skrabec@gmail.com designates 209.85.218.44 as permitted sender) smtp.mailfrom=jernej.skrabec@gmail.com 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1707476117; a=rsa-sha256; cv=none; b=mYD22+8YJ51YmkoborM7ojzEy6+c8+JWZxU3QiKVDrJl+MZxylx15Ta7xa8r6bTaMjDHV3 3BKxC8vTj1ZrVvGf8eFJsIFTUm4Z5GP17VpnIpSzhFwr1i65U0GTxlQXtu4qwFJt9/ii1S hDzuRTaCYnqPGJ+0DqSNLluC4XCrOlU= Received: by mail-ej1-f44.google.com with SMTP id a640c23a62f3a-a2f22bfb4e6so107595366b.0 for ; Fri, 09 Feb 2024 02:55:16 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1707476116; x=1708080916; darn=kvack.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:to:from:from:to:cc:subject:date:message-id :reply-to; bh=VPDCxvBNMC7jVwM9lF/rwisiu2UQZms91Q9LKR4ZUe8=; b=BSRl/zcjArQSMTt3mFkxYNfzK+F13y7ezbeylqcoqffL8yOKxA040g3FNztHeu00m5 mCSd9VQesK22pXimobmjzo1UfzmHxZKOXDounJcsruXmby8rEZJwiwEFYFaHgomy/prb HrNIrVdzvfNj0e58ia381NtqwjWBF1JDm/pgi/QrhM+8HKUlUiZXG+PYJgKsUL28Fh0Z 23CARqr7ESnPiJCR6BQL7K6yTcZZNBoVqsOCpMKmBfYlDAZhQ3OcNobpILJvZ9v/FQ7u zdQDpKaT4gY2B64vJFMW5C1qhK4zvJmLF5aV63V/PusoaNb+sOHUQe5044QKVfgGz5Cy VfOg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1707476116; x=1708080916;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:to:from: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=VPDCxvBNMC7jVwM9lF/rwisiu2UQZms91Q9LKR4ZUe8=; b=b9jyhOdVUS9epaL0O/T+rjbooXLArivf8sWjB+EhghPIuRaXnTe51UtloISqZvmVaZ 1BUPPAQQAHCkzKnJNzrvKAtLz9ApehdkSiMuC5w4IdUMnZD2dtGT8mtLXTXXd2sMZUUI zt9XFoLr0ABQ8gHngagrnlXsqvswukZka8foJjsYICJJUFLPheowRuCKV5TEW63Rm4RV SHKwUkrPE9j6e4xFZvcamIdjkgcqhoXUunJQdh+jRxGriMPixM1VLGclaiavxlTvShlb l4kRGSUQAQ1OVyXCYy8wpz3y40Rf5DiAMuttxuizDp/Mntwy83EGaf98EcTBhrP0BysJ OHcA== X-Forwarded-Encrypted: i=1; AJvYcCWdQ7vmyxon7zWbPJjcvFGAeTb8S8zaFBsrjZKbqNVvHNNklkJ3tC/W4MSRrWK14aLSkdGH5SvyV1Xup8GKKZ6+CVQ= X-Gm-Message-State: AOJu0Yz/wiA9Oo9AYcjrac5SZeuSyeEYGPN4VfJ2Jzlu8AI27F7IA+pX ItWF/ctL8Guu0/yAPKThLbUO3zti+AZAK4aWEltDGJqtBjzQ6kyU X-Google-Smtp-Source: AGHT+IH8fQC4BYcatf4eNnFGSb58UqS4zJtebYfp5Tkvc0uum0cdKtMKpIELju2LqVMZ4Dh9GK/KUg== X-Received: by 2002:a17:906:f9d1:b0:a35:103e:3614 with SMTP id lj17-20020a170906f9d100b00a35103e3614mr863231ejb.52.1707476115517; Fri, 09 Feb 2024 02:55:15 -0800 (PST) X-Forwarded-Encrypted: i=1; AJvYcCW0W2ig//yQ03IYUX8CzVxAEgCm8ndS3T1j4w20EZR4F7pSO46B0Ssj3CYd8S2QKwCcARm6ki3u9e+DBebFxzoEmI0oAbFUYYnNmQnIfRpW9iMLjJG04+63v/Bw70+28ySDWZpJTWzL6cI2ZNkUJZJBwsdxGXcv13Cex5FSXWQ/rA9VbY9FqqY9gqP3vr4cmM/C3FOjfKS8JqLEr7MLEXtAgcq9EhKu+atw3ez0PoqAKQG/JmJIV2N3c6/pHD4PEA5X2XFnqx8RZrsvXH+e/FBSspe0y9uDFUUpbR+LzWYkl9acy+GflcK9HZwzgdhL5XJATWhk/+YNWJSYJgI+XFcILFpe3zGY7mon1YpeqDQFNax5MEtzOpB5DFscrKJeiFJa/7oEMJeHdR8nIb74rJbhsoPHQM5vd0oKFnfn7QtJHpVf89dKVi8weQbjAgJ8g2mC1rBg2UiWropsPA72suo7mEQ2M8/tfdoGloKbAuI+XKt7MyeE0A4AUXuhmNfplAnS7k3f5b8skGR7wFI1yF/DOwTR9dk2x5l3vM5QHJJa/wXVNHmAM7ZtMSHzOAcf7sB/1Dk6rr6D6sBvSBih/Yi7A3mTIUvJfrTMeAH3bu+fBav/NdxOlr0OWM9Aut74GPCsiTwnDNmslfl6+GV9NyNqTeUeLd6jND27dWT/VhjfxwKpej42Iobb9GYk/l2DwagtHAj1C6DTy4Tyejx0ACCc3UnkebndWh0nS1SilTf6sRtD17hmcAGj6yEScljW6quvxOQyxq1rGybRxq+XfDHNKiGkrJcTfhs7AOxIFi8aJl3Fnj8/k/Q+dBj1ROIQhnjUeOw/Ex01Ynamfb6VACenMHuYjs2DjUiRQe5nrAPgYOyUOHlpV/SI9NViaJOezY/A87rwGJG3CngeT5OAMkMDIqpvq62KcNN+aLUv/t7qFkaBjYyzTSgLR+iN0D O+phbXFZ pZJknOwjoo5SfgsL5gCYFRu5BCGxsd7nqNZTS9Hzq/tcc4IS/I7MGp6eiH+iCXIfdGAUgh4wOUbiOFGVsT9Z4idnsbB4hg5CGFiXSz6dgATKIgfsFvnmH4aQsC8iOJY2gmUAl3aIcQoEvOGdClgxelpZRKICgoSZzGK6kDqTQ6vgChMcBthxj+Rdb0aQRz1GtwtU+RcgF48fqY/UxEv4oUdUktTlEpJvnVT+0OlR5hZMlrAkTb4orEqBQKit/397dC5qzNVOLhyViUGFZVmUj8RcXSSScjXz/1Qn6eg+H7iKlae2EqEcdkYUiIBH/c/9zREOdzHiAGPOLatjckrAsePGDqYRUI/w0KCpzynCVjY1wV3GpyCS/noMczEQKDj7rAfUyB7PzDOalH/Cd8ScBs3aHXlv9Eo6z+MLOLKzJwD/e02tmzYjM86xU4WeM23qznU1N3jw777w== Received: from jernej-laptop.localnet (APN-123-244-98-gprs.simobil.net. [46.123.244.98]) by smtp.gmail.com with ESMTPSA id cu7-20020a170906ba8700b00a37b795348fsm629101ejd.127.2024.02.09.02.55.10 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 09 Feb 2024 02:55:14 -0800 (PST) From: Jernej =?utf-8?B?xaBrcmFiZWM=?= To: akpm@linux-foundation.org, alim.akhtar@samsung.com, alyssa@rosenzweig.io, asahi@lists.linux.dev, baolu.lu@linux.intel.com, bhelgaas@google.com, cgroups@vger.kernel.org, corbet@lwn.net, david@redhat.com, dwmw2@infradead.org, hannes@cmpxchg.org, heiko@sntech.de, iommu@lists.linux.dev, jonathanh@nvidia.com, joro@8bytes.org, krzysztof.kozlowski@linaro.org, linux-doc@vger.kernel.org, linux-fsdevel@vger.kernel.org, linux-kernel@vger.kernel.org, linux-mm@kvack.org, linux-rockchip@lists.infradead.org, linux-samsung-soc@vger.kernel.org, linux-sunxi@lists.linux.dev, linux-tegra@vger.kernel.org, lizefan.x@bytedance.com, marcan@marcan.st, mhiramat@kernel.org, m.szyprowski@samsung.com, pasha.tatashin@soleen.com, paulmck@kernel.org, rdunlap@infradead.org, robin.murphy@arm.com, samuel@sholland.org, suravee.suthikulpanit@amd.com, sven@svenpeter.dev, thierry.reding@gmail.com, tj@kernel.org, tomas.mudrunka@gmail.com, vdumpa@nvidia.com, wens@csie.org, will@kernel.org, yu-cheng.yu@intel.com, rientjes@google.com, bagasdotme@gmail.com, mkoutny@suse.com, Pasha Tatashin Subject: Re: [PATCH v4 07/10] iommu/sun50i: use page allocation function provided by iommu-pages.h Date: Fri, 09 Feb 2024 11:55:09 +0100 Message-ID: <2718393.mvXUDI8C0e@jernej-laptop> In-Reply-To: <20240207174102.1486130-8-pasha.tatashin@soleen.com> References: <20240207174102.1486130-1-pasha.tatashin@soleen.com> <20240207174102.1486130-8-pasha.tatashin@soleen.com> MIME-Version: 1.0 Content-Transfer-Encoding: 7Bit Content-Type: text/plain; charset="us-ascii" X-Rspam-User: X-Stat-Signature: qf7q3qydjj71z3gju5wgbxsjyyudw831 X-Rspamd-Server: rspam07 X-Rspamd-Queue-Id: 49500A0014 X-HE-Tag: 1707476117-885954 X-HE-Meta: U2FsdGVkX19uWuzUtItrOIBEhlnOm80ceawUXihvFBjdlkjXJmT0iKyo7ZjCTVh5DT6T7haKgefIWkTt7VqBV9aPS7i8BX213ZZSXd5hazR2gGFuBNDYc8JOuKnX0A9qG+miwk7sodGOnNyAv+eNUfLvVfKv3ESA8nphtCUnxrYdXGoadc3gUVcSrrUnLP8lJD9AIkLkA3ntMs7aUB7Nntgo6SWeHAE+Mw9UhbeQ0V3GIVpJDmZi0GT2O93s8srQRMtCA/x6KZjkJqzKZr/86Ul+sHNM1u0+jPwkQinVVjxK3TCTdxG8bk6f75fkUUnOA+yNBIdICnSK2Y+Im42YOj4dLdRU9jL1g6nj5CRcAbQqIb84OD7bhsMW80Acy/eHoRqyyoQnhIG+hF3VdcrR6PsNjvVn7lnQp+CQsKQ6IfZyydl7czXsGQWyDMo7FLHfBxo4Bf+LiZLrYyoFYIWJqgiSTUdgTX3fjJYPGG3hyMQMvFn/M+GmitG5X4p1znXmUtuClRpRY5OyLFVX72RVYP8sOPgcT+qyzqiQiaCzzNp0LCRxuHmljwuo6twcrl0bwhdlGxmlt1EpXwpM6FS95AdhbtfLNQmqQfKTAJt2dnOx7TXdAkrZoSLEG8Q4b4jPtQ273LIUi9xm+pgZOQeFBVrsF1Mv+WRAFqITHWUb9Qu69g07ldnqXVABySLrnOw8/V9exViqSrOZTiZcDrxpK4UfBN4RIPt8wIOgerXSCRwTrSWhv3cqofVMoJ87MFqm84B1kpQoOf8Qu6ySHzlJ4AGbsANMzfZBAt8nb5ysE0yJI6YhkVFgHeW9Gl0xwKswHna+hj6NM1QQ+AWFhIHENAUBxInUbmDyhi7pzP9MigHA5oSkM54oSa91y+oZnpYRzWYgtdxOxq5usb/uLd+GQZCE5GrYr65HJegLxkgp2i9AovZFh59MCWOAZBF4pMeoQSIr9Bwzi0HYE0FJHV5 OTy5veH7 0L8syB9/lDJU6eQSDkf+1XaueD+xdZTxyMBykQQSLE2zLhW0YynQcFSuWwi3EL7DZ8z1HWtOP4peIh5G5Dy+dgpX8unDUU6PNXwDlv8gDnU701G/ywzONM6VR+cdCgIFeU9XNZkq2CeX5bSNIAAvDR1iwF7Muea/rNE6mdHKNlgGOWNdJW+BY2Cg4EcPdHpDYDborwx7CWg4q9JaK08RChEELQMKVk1ktu+tUfFUTu7jzcDjdjrQu/jyyQvUGSD+Jbhb2YTK+RXMgRY7tEDsby8nLha6SSgGfdSoJ5GykrAZPIIBuqwivIjeyBY1k1ZaN+HlasUpCreJb11M4XYwpLLH4CBUFFw66tLAOC0LFSsli2DBevlJAP/zhWmFPukN93BVzuv25uiXYu7SpxCmJ4DtMJ4+52AiNeuJyyHM/qKvwcKGi9CM6TXK/qS27rvGw6zKXxAKlZvQSrDwzKr1ZmUMenCyAt+r6Eww7n9LSX92Do8va/Wkjha5W+sc4cnoh7rd4M5WOLE+FSReGD9kzF8hrohUSNcjixddeo/xRJvwAVOMvOfSef4fJDg9Xo7ECgairebOr8Y40HVRCfF6F7g0t6kxMVS+WiRL239nbvjcGDNG4TnINqxf6Fcl5P3O0oJJYAG4MXeoaWsS4HtWgTtEUuo9eX6p4IRH/tjSBYx/RNnealuIIta9xzw== X-Bogosity: Ham, tests=bogofilter, spamicity=0.000008,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: Dne sreda, 07. februar 2024 ob 18:40:59 CET je Pasha Tatashin napisal(a): > Convert iommu/sun50i-iommu.c to use the new page allocation functions > provided in iommu-pages.h. > > Signed-off-by: Pasha Tatashin > Acked-by: David Rientjes > Tested-by: Bagas Sanjaya Acked-by: Jernej Skrabec Best regards, Jernej